That Type II guy in GWX was me.
And yes, I've done it now FOUR times (when I posted in the thread originally it was only 2 times). The trick is where you do your hunting. For the Type II, especially the Type IID, the dive time is the thing that's saved my *** so many times I've lost count.
But, if I remember, my trick for my first two careers was to move ASAP to the Black Sea and the Flotilla that operated there.
Since then, I've also gotten another two careers that lasted the entire war. One was completely done in a VII, the other started in a II before moving to a XI, then a VII around 42.
I guess you have to be lucky, but also take VERY VERY VERY few risks. I rarely do anything aggressive if I'm not 100% sure that I can survive the consequences.
